Cleaning Operations Team Leader
The closing date is 06 November 2025
Job summary
Our Cleaning Operations Team Leader will be reporting to our Deputy Cleaning Operations Manager; this is 1 of 3 posts providing service cover from 06:00 hours – 20:00 hours, 7 days a week on a rota basis.
Our Cleaning Team Leader support the day-to-day management of c129 WTE Healthcare Cleaning staff and are vital to maintaining our Trust's Cleaning and Infection Control policies, ensuring a clean and safe environment for patients, staff and visitors.
We currently will be recruiting for 2 positions, both 30 hours per week, permanent roles.
Main duties of the job
- To be visible on the "shop floor"; supporting Cleaning Operations staff, carrying out visual inspections of cleaning standards, ensuring cleaning tasks and cleaning sign off sheets are undertaken and completed in line with the required cleaning standards
- Under the direction of our Deputy Cleaning Manager, support the delivery of the highest standard of cleaning services to patients, staff and visitors
- Play a key role in implementing the proposed new cleaning operations service model to ensure high quality cleaning services are delivered to the NHS National Standards of Cleanliness and to our Trust's Cleaning and Infection Control policies

Job description
Job responsibilities
- Provide excellent customer services to our patients, colleagues and members of the public at all times. Communicate effectively and in a timely manner with a range of hospital staff, the public, patients and colleagues across our Trust
- Communicate effectively with staff at all levels of the organisation and with patients and external suppliers
- Participate in meetings as required e.g. staff team meetings, cleaning standards, matrons meetings and operational management team briefings as required
- Assist the Cleaning Operations team by providing an effective cascade of information to all Cleaning Operations staff
- Maintain good handover processes to supervisor colleagues as part of the working rota
- Respond positively to external inspections, such as unannounced CQC or Environmental Health attendance, PLACE, recognising when to escalate issues to line managers
- Maintain good working relationships with colleagues
- Respond with humanity and kindness to every person, by listening attentively and respecting others in conversations
- Act as a role model, valuing everyone's opinion and experiences, treating your team members equally and with respect
- Strive to provide excellent, innovative services that helps our patients/clients/customers have a good and professionally delivered healthcare experience
- Be helpful, courteous and kind to colleagues, staff, patients and visitors at all times
- Work in conjunction with clinical and non-clinical staff to ensure appropriate access is gained in order to clean and operate within specific areas
- Actively participate in the provision of quality assurance and performance monitoring of our Trust's cleaning services
- Support our Cleaning Operations Leadership team to ensure all Trust and Workforce division targets are met for mandatory/essential training and performance and achievement reviews
- Assist with promoting incident reporting within cleaning operations services and ensure incidents are managed and reported appropriately and that lessons learned are put into effect
- Promote infection control awareness and support monitoring and infection-reduction measures
- Ensure that all waste is correctly sorted into the appropriate waste streams, label and dispose of all waste streams from the ward/department, observing all relevant recycling policies and procedures and take to recognised designated points
- Investigate and respond to customer, service user and employee complaints/feedback thoroughly and professionally, ensuring a robust plan is in place to meet service level agreements and patient needs where appropriate, or escalate to our Deputy Cleaning Manager
- Support our Deputy Cleaning Manager to effectively prioritise the daily cleaning operations service and daily staffing allocation against agreed rotas, resolving any staffing issues on a daily basis
